Tiny Footprint, Massive Connectivity
Geekom clearly understands that a mini PC's primary job is to blend in, not to be an eyesore. Their designs are typically sleek, modern, and understated. But the real unsung hero here is the port selection. You almost always get a generous array: USB-A and USB-C ports for all your peripherals, HDMI and DisplayPort outputs capable of driving one, sometimes even two, monitors in glorious 4K resolution, an Ethernet port for that rock-solid wired connection, built-in Wi-Fi and Bluetooth, and, of course, your standard audio jack. This extensive connectivity means you can effortlessly hook up your existing keyboard, mouse, webcam, external hard drives – all the essentials – without a second thought. Finding Your Ideal Geekom Companion
Geekom offers a few different tiers of models, generally catering to varying needs and budgets. Typically, you'll find:
- The Everyday Essentials: Think Intel Celeron or Pentium chips. These are your absolute go-to for basic web browsing, email correspondence, and word processing tasks. They are remarkably affordable and incredibly efficient.
- The All-Rounders: Often featuring Intel Core i3 or i5 processors, these strike that perfect balance for the majority of users. They offer excellent multitasking capabilities and a generally smooth, lag-free experience.
- The Power Players: These are the higher-end options, usually equipped with Core i5 or i7 processors, more generous amounts of RAM, and faster storage solutions. These are designed for those who require that extra bit of horsepower for more demanding applications.
